Which of the following is TRUE about the stages of grieving?A.Each stage should be experienced only once for each loss.B.Everyone must move through the stages in the same order.C.Progressing through these stages will help to deal with loss in a healthy manner.D.none of the abovePlease select the best answer from the choices provided.ABCD

Sagot :

Grief can be defined as a natural response to loss. Some of the most common states of grieving are denial, isolation, anger, depression, and acceptance.

  • The statement 'Progressing through these stages will help to deal with loss in a healthy manner' about the stages of grieving is TRUE (Option C).

  • Grief refers to the emotional suffering that has come when someone close has died.

  • Actions such as avoid, ignoring, or escaping are not good feelings to deal with grief effectively (they are unhealthy).
